public FrameGIF Clone() { FrameGIF clone = new FrameGIF() { bitmap = bitmap, wbitmap = wbitmap.Clone(), Speed = Speed }; return(clone); }
private void CopyFrame_Clicked(object sender, RoutedEventArgs e) { if (!FrameContainer.HasItems) { return; } var frame = FrameContainer.SelectedItem as FrameGIF; if (frame == null) { return; } FrameGIF copiedFrame = frame.Clone(); frameCollection.Add(copiedFrame); }